Utilizing Online Conversion Tools for JPG to WEBP
Choose a reliable conversion website such as CloudConvert or Convertio. These platforms support multiple file types and offer user-friendly interfaces that simplify the process. Ensure to check the maximum file size limit before uploading your images.
Most of these services provide batch processing capabilities, allowing the upload of several images simultaneously, which can save significant time. Look for options that let you select multiple files at once to streamline your workflow.
Adjust settings to optimize output quality. Some tools offer customization options for compression levels, affecting the final file size without compromising image clarity. Experiment with different configurations to find the best balance for your needs.
After conversion, always preview the results. Most online tools allow you to view the changed image before downloading, ensuring the quality meets your expectations. If you notice discrepancies, you can easily repeat the process with modified settings.
Take advantage of cloud storage integration features. Many websites allow direct saving to services like Google Drive or Dropbox. This ensures that your files are securely stored and easily accessible without clogging your local drive.
Finally, keep your image backup routine in mind. Before starting the conversion, create copies of your original files. This ensures that you have unaltered versions in case you need to revert changes or try different conversion settings later.
Adjusting Settings for Optimal Image Quality
Set the quality parameter between 70% and 85% for a balance between size and clarity. This range typically preserves detail while ensuring smaller file sizes.
Utilize the method of lossless compression for images requiring maximum fidelity. This approach maintains original data without loss and is ideal for graphics or detailed visuals.
Experiment with different compression settings to determine the best outcome for various images. A lower compression level may result in a clearer image, while a higher level will reduce file size more dramatically.

If supported by the tool, utilize the sharpness adjustment. This can enhance edge definition, making the result appear more vivid without noticeably increasing file size.
Pay attention to metadata options; stripping unnecessary data can further reduce the final size while keeping the essential qualities of the image intact.
Lastly, preview the image after adjustments before finalizing. This allows for immediate assessment, ensuring the desired quality is matched with the file size efficiency. Make iterative changes as needed to achieve the best visual result.
